In this video covered by Huffington Post we get an insight into Jeeno Joseph’s dance journey , an American India Bharatnatyam Dancer. This Dancer Found Inner Peace By Breaking Gender Stereotypes In Indian Dance. He shares “It requires a sense of subtlety. There are no restrictions in Bharatanatyam about the roles that male or female dancers can take on. Each performer is essentially a blank canvas on which any character or story can be painted. That means that male dancers can be tasked with playing Devi, the sum of all manifestations of the mother goddess, while female dancers may portray the valiant and heroic Lord Rama.”
